FDA Approves Fourth Product Under National Priority Voucher Program, Higher Dose Semaglutide
The FDA approved a new higher dose (7.2 mg) of Wegovy (semaglutide) injection for weight loss and long-term maintenance of weight loss in certain adult patients. This approval marks the fourth product approved under the Commissioner's National Priority Voucher pilot program.
View FDA SourceFDA Warns 30 Telehealth Companies Against Illegal Marketing of Compounded GLP-1s
The FDA issued 30 warning letters to telehealth companies for making false or misleading claims regarding compounded GLP-1 products offered on their websites. This enforcement action targets illegal marketing practices by telehealth providers offering weight loss services.
View FDA SourceWhat to Do If Your Provider Is Flagged
An FDA alert does not always mean your medication is unsafe. Many alerts are administrative or related to labeling and marketing practices, not product safety.
Read the full FDA notice linked in the alert. Understand whether the issue affects the medication you are taking or only certain product batches or business practices.
Ask your provider about the alert and what steps they are taking in response. A reputable provider will be transparent about any FDA communications.
Your primary care physician can help you evaluate whether to continue, pause, or switch your GLP-1 treatment based on the specific alert and your health history.
If you experience adverse effects or suspect a safety issue, report it directly to the FDA through their MedWatch program at fda.gov/medwatch.
